Important Considerations
- Always test any cleaning solution on a small, inconspicuous area first to ensure it does not damage the surface.
- Use protective gloves when handling chemicals like brake cleaner or bleach to avoid skin irritation.
- After removing tint from taillights, consider re-sealing them to protect against future damage.
FAQs About Removing Lens Tint Spray
- Can I use acetone?
Acetone can be effective but may also damage plastic surfaces. Use it cautiously. - Will these methods scratch my lenses?
Using abrasive materials can scratch lenses; opt for soft cloths and gentle scrubbing. - Is there a professional option?
If DIY methods seem risky, consider taking your items to a professional detailer or optician.
